Describe the data update difference between operational and analytical data.
crimeas [40]

Operational data is used to sustain applications that help facilitate operations.

These databases are directed to as application-oriented. Analytical data is used to examine one or more business areas, such as sales, costs, or profit

<h3>What is the distinction between operational and information-analytical systems?</h3>

Operational systems are prepared to deal with the running values of data. Informational Systems deal with the collection, collection, and deriving of information from data.

<h3>What is the distinction between operational and analytical reporting?</h3>

Analytical reporting is introduced toward supporting the strategic and preparing functions of senior management.

Functional reporting is oriented toward helping the day-to-day organizational functions.
